The are no alphabets native to the Americas as far as any has ever discovered. Most native writing systems are syllabic or pictographic.
The alphabet most widely used in the Americas is the Latin alphabet, which was brought by the Europeans. It is used for English, Portuguese, Spanish, French, Dutch, and most other minority languages of North and South America.
